System overview
The DEVIreg™ 850 system is capable of keeping outdoor areas free of ice and snow.
The DEVIreg™ 850 can handle up to 2 independent areas, in any of the following
combinations:

When more than 1 area is controlled by the DEVIreg™ 850 system, it is also possible to
prioritize the areas. Prioritizing makes it possible to operate 2 areas, even if the needed
power for 2 areas is not present.
The DEVIreg™ 850 is fully automatic and operated digitally by means of the intel-
ligent sensors located in the heated terrain. Each sensor measures both temperature
and moisture, and the system turns the heating elements on and o based on these
readings. By combining moisture and temperature readings, the system is able to save
around 75% energy compared to systems which only measure temperature readings.
The digital sensors used for the DEVIreg™ 850 also provide the most exact readings
when compared with corresponding analogue systems. The result is optimum func-
tionality and low energy consumption.

Possible alarms during operation
Clogged drain
Description: When clogged drain warning has been enabled, an alarm is raised
when the system constantly has been detecting moisture for 14
days.
y
If the DEVIreg™ 850 controls more than 1 system, and prioritiz-
ing has been enabled, the time before clogged drain warning
for the down-prioritized system, can be much longer. The
time is only updated, when the system actually is allowed to
heat the area (e.g. the up-prioritized system is not heating)
Solution: - Check gutter and down pipes for any obstacles preventing the
melting water to ow away.
- Check if sensors are covered with dirt.
Missing sensor
Description: When the connection to a sensor is lost, the DEVIreg™ 850 alarms
the user. At the same time the DEVIreg™ 850 automatically switch-
es the system to “Constant O” mode, and user interaction with
the DEVIreg™ 850 is needed.
Solution: - Acknowledge error and go to “Installer Site” in the menu system
and select “Change System”.
- Contact your local installer to get a replacement.
New sensor added
Description: When a new sensor is added, the DEVIreg™ 850 alarms the user and
at the same time automatically switches to “Constant O” mode.
User interaction is needed in order to correct the error.
Solution: Acknowledge error and go to “Installer Site” in the menu system
and select “Change System”.
Sensor malfunction
Description: When something is wrong with the readings from connected sen-
sors to the DEVIreg™ 850, an alarm is raised.
Not all error prone sensors can be discovered using this fea-
ture!
Solution: - Acknowledge error and go to “Installer Site” in the menu system
and select “Change System”.
- Contact your local service centre to get a replacement.

Changing parameters and performance of systems
Several parameters for each system can be changed during and after the installation.
For a complete understanding of how these parameters aect the performance of the
roof and ground system, please refer to Appendix B: “How it works”.
Only change the DEVIreg™ 850 parameters if you are aware of the eects of
your actions. Reference: Appendix A: Installer menu
Roof system
Melting temperature
Changing the melting temperature will aect when the system is activated in case of
moisture and low temperatures.
The factory setting is 1.5°C. This means that the heating system will be activated if the
temperature falls below 1.5°C and moisture is detected.
Moisture level
The “moisture level” decides when the system detects moist.
The factory setting is 50 (on a scale from 5 to 95). The lower the setting, the more sensi-
tive the system is to moisture.
Post-heat
Once the sensor has detected that the roof/gutter is dry and free of ice and snow the
system will keep heating for another hour (default). If you wish to increase/decrease
this time see appendix A: Installer menu.
The factory setting is 1 hour (on a scale from 0 to 9 hours)
Priority
When using the DEVIreg™ 850 as a dual or combi system, it is possible to prioritize the
systems. When the priority of 2 systems is equal, both systems can heat at the same
time. If the priority of the 2 systems diers, and both systems want to heat, only the
system with the highest priority is allowed to heat.
The factory setting is 1 (highest priority) for all systems.
Clogged drain
It is possible to enable and disable the “Clogged drain warning”.
The factory setting is “Warning On”.
System and sensor name
It is possible to change the names of the system and connected sensors (see appendix
A: Installer menu.
User Manual

9
Ground system
Melting temperature
Changing the melting temperature will aect when the system is activated in case of
moisture and low temperatures.
The factory setting is 4°C. This means that the heating system will be activated if the
temperature falls below 4°C and moisture is detected.
Standby temperature (maintained ground temperature)
The higher the standby temperature the faster the system will be able to melt ice and
snow. On the other hand the higher the standby temperature the higher the running
costs. So, determining the standby temperature is a trade-o between fast melting or
low running costs. The factory setting is -3 C°.
Moisture level
The “moisture level” decides when the system detects moist.
The factory setting is 50 (on a scale from 5 to 95). The lower the setting, the more sensi-
tive the system is to moisture.
Post-heat
Once the sensor has detected that the roof/gutter is dry and free of ice and snow the
system will keep heating for another hour (default). If you wish to increase/decrease
this time see appendix A: Installer menu.
The factory setting is 1 hour (on a scale from 0 to 9 hours)
Priority
When using the DEVIreg™ 850 as a dual or combi system, it is possible to prioritize the
systems. When the priority of 2 systems is equal, both systems can heat at the same
time. If the priority of the 2 systems diers, and both systems want to heat, only the
system with the highest priority is allowed to heat.
The factory setting is 1 (highest priority) for all systems.
Clogged drain
It is possible to enable and disable the “Clogged drain warning”.
The factory setting is “Warning On”.
System and sensor name
It is possible to change the names of the system and connected sensors.

Placement
The DEVIreg™ 850 and power supply are designed for DIN rail mounting. When mount-
ing please be aware of the following conditions:
The DEVIreg™ 850 is designed and approved to operate in the temperature
range -10°C to 40°C.
The DEVIreg™ 850 is only IP20 protected, thus not water resistant.
The installer must ensure proper enclosure of the DEVIreg™ 850 according to
national standards (electrical safety).
